I love lists and I love music. When I saw that some young whippersnapper, born in 1977, compiled a list of his favorite albums for every year that he lived, I thought, that’s for me! But damn it’s a lot of work. It’s also very difficult to pick just one album per year when in some years, there are just impossible picks to narrow to one. I struggled with Nirvana’s Nevermind and Massive Attack’s Blue Lines. 1967 & 1968 were near impossible, as so much great music came from that era. But it’s now done for your perusal and criticism.

1956    Brilliant Corners    Thelonious Monk
1957    The Chirpin’ Crickets    The Crickets
1958    Freedom Suite    Sonny Rollins
1959    Kind of Blue    Miles Davis
1960    Back at the Chicken Shack    Jimmy Smith
1961    Oh Yeah    Charles Mingus
1962    Green Onions    Booker T. & the MG’s
1963    Please, Please Me    The Beatles
1964    Hard Day’s Night    The Beatles
1965    Hollies    Hollies
1966    Revolver    The Beatles
1967    The Doors    The Doors
1968    The Beatles (White Album)    The Beatles
1969    Arthur (Or the Decline and Fall of the British Empire)     The Kinks
1970    Layla & Other Assorted Love Songs    Derek & the Dominos
1971    What’s Going On    Marvin Gaye
1972    Exile on Main Street    The Rolling Stones
1973    Dark Side of the Moon    Pink Floyd
1974    Natty Dread    Bob Marley
1975    Pressure Drop    Robert Palmer
1976    Howlin’ Wind    Graham Parker
1977    The Clash    The Clash
1978    Jesus of Cool    Nick Lowe
1979    London Calling    The Clash
1980    Sound Affects    The Jam
1981    Coup de Grace    Mink DeVille
1982    Night and Day    Joe Jackson
1983    Texas Flood    Stevie Ray Vaughan & Double Trouble
1984    Born in the U.S.A.    Bruce Springsteen
1985    This is the Sea    The Waterboys
1986    The Queen is Dead    The Smiths
1987    Joshua Tree    U2
1988    The Trinity Sessions    The Cowboy Junkies
1989    The Stone Roses    Stone Roses
1990    Pills ‘n’ Thrills & Bellyaches    The Happy Mondays
1991    Blue Lines    Massive Attack
1992    Hollywood Town Hall    The Jayhawks
1993    In Utero    Nirvana
1994    Definitely Maybe    Oasis
1995    (What’s the Story) Morning Glory    Oasis
1996    Odelay    Beck
1997    OK Computer    Radiohead
1998    Car Wheels on a Gravel Road    Lucinda Williams
1999    69 Love Songs: Volume 1    Magnetic Fields
2000    Stankonia    OutKast
2001    Gorillaz    Gorillaz
2002    Yoshimi Battles the Pink Robots    The Flaming Lips
2003    Dear Catastrophe Waitress    Belle & Sebastian
2004    Franz Ferdinand    Franz Ferdinand
2005    Front Parlour Ballads    Richard Thompson
2006    Yell Fire!    Michael Franti & Spearhead
2007    Sky Blue Sky    Wilco
2008    22 Dreams    Paul Weller
